Former hostage Romi Gonen says that a senior Hamas commander offered to move her to the top of the organization's release list in exchange for her silence over the sexual assaults she experienced during her 471-day captivity.
In the second part of an interview aired Thursday evening on Keshet 12's "Uvda" ("Fact") program, Gonen said that she spoke by phone with Izz al-Din al-Haddad, currently the head of Hamas' military wing in the Gaza Strip, about the sexual assaults.
"At some point, they came and took me to the commanders' room upstairs. They told me to put on a hijab," she said. "I thought they were going to kill me; I was afraid of this conversation. There was a telephone waiting for me there, and someone said 'Hello' to me in Hebrew. I knew he was a high ranking commander... He said to me, 'I understand a situation happened, I want to hear what happened'."

"I told him everything," Gonen added. "He told me he would find him (the attacker), and also that because of what happened to me he would put me at the top of the list to go home. on the 55th day of the war. He told me he wanted to make some kind of deal with me."
